You can now watch the entire Happy Tree Friends Season 1 Episode 17 movie online in high-definition quality, complete with English subtitles for a better viewing experience. Best of all, there’s no need to download anything—simply stream it directly from your device anytime, anywhere.
Happy Tree Friends: Mime cheers up a hospital-ridden Toothy with some death-defying acts! Wait, scratch the "defying" part.